Output 5f50538f3076da01a75ee1e798aac86663ed3f7639804b48b55af65781b92907:1

value
11010320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a47727a318c59cbef3451d42c15737ba2dc090c OP_EQUAL
address
345y5mWbD1hYSxiVbuP6GRKH7fh3t8r5YC
transaction
5f50538f3076da01a75ee1e798aac86663ed3f7639804b48b55af65781b92907
confirmations
423852
spent
true